Meridia #1
This first volume of Meridia — subtitled Les fleurs de Dorkéîne — announces a richly atmospheric French fantasy from Thierry Gloris and Joël Mouclier, published by Delcourt in 2011. The painted cover draws the eye immediately to a solemn young figure at center, cradling a handful of deep-red blossoms, while behind them loom a fierce woman in a collar, a red-eyed mechanical beast, and a brooding young man — a cast that promises intrigue, danger, and dark wonder. The moody crimson palette and painterly style make this an immediately compelling entry point into what looks like a world of gothic fantasy and uneasy alliances.
